Answer: The circumference of this circle with 3 for pi is 108 m.

Step-by-step explanation: The formula for the circumference of a circle is 2 pi r. So, plug in the values. 2 x 3 x 18 is equal to 108. Therefore, the circumference of this circle is 108 m.
